WebThe picture above shows how people feel as they go through the stages of cultural adjustment. Let’s look at the stages of adjustment, including culture shock, in more detail. 1. The honeymoon phase. When you first arrive in the USA, you may feel happy and excited. You may have lots of goals and expectations for what will happen in your new life. WebFeb 28, 2024 · 18 Culture Shock Examples. Culture shock is what people experience when they are exposed to a culture vastly different from their own. It is the feeling of disorientation and discomfort a person feels when moving from a familiar to an unfamiliar place.
